라이브러리

[PHP] ocicommit - oci_commit의 별칭




PHP에서 OCI-Commit


OCI-Commit은 Oracle Database와의 통신을 위해 Oracle Client Library를 사용하는 PHP에서 사용하는 함수입니다. OCI-Commit은 트랜잭션을 커밋하는 데 사용됩니다.

# OCI-Commit 함수


OCI-Commit 함수는 Oracle Database와의 통신을 위해 사용되는 함수입니다. 이 함수는 트랜잭션을 커밋하는 데 사용됩니다.

#hostingforum.kr
php

oci_commit($conn);



# OCI-Commit 함수의 파라미터


OCI-Commit 함수의 파라미터는 다음과 같습니다.

- `$conn`: Oracle Database와의 통신을 위해 사용되는 커넥션 객체입니다.

# OCI-Commit 함수의 예제


OCI-Commit 함수의 예제는 다음과 같습니다.

#hostingforum.kr
php

//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 생성합니다.

$conn = oci_connect('사용자 이름', '비밀번호', 'Oracle Database 주소');



//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 확인합니다.

if (!$conn) {

    $m = oci_error();

    echo $m['message'];

    exit;

}



// Oracle Database에 INSERT 문을 실행합니다.

$stmt = oci_parse($conn, "INSERT INTO 테이블 이름 (컬럼 이름) VALUES ('값')");

oci_execute($stmt);



// OCI-Commit 함수를 호출합니다.

oci_commit($conn);



// Oracle Database와의 통신을 종료합니다.

oci_close($conn);



# OCI-Commit 함수의 사용 예제


OCI-Commit 함수의 사용 예제는 다음과 같습니다.

#hostingforum.kr
php

//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 생성합니다.

$conn = oci_connect('사용자 이름', '비밀번호', 'Oracle Database 주소');



//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 확인합니다.

if (!$conn) {

    $m = oci_error();

    echo $m['message'];

    exit;

}



// Oracle Database에 INSERT 문을 실행합니다.

$stmt = oci_parse($conn, "INSERT INTO 테이블 이름 (컬럼 이름) VALUES ('값')");

oci_execute($stmt);



// OCI-Commit 함수를 호출합니다.

oci_commit($conn);



// Oracle Database에 UPDATE 문을 실행합니다.

$stmt = oci_parse($conn, "UPDATE 테이블 이름 SET 컬럼 이름 = '값' WHERE 조건");

oci_execute($stmt);



// OCI-Commit 함수를 호출합니다.

oci_commit($conn);



// Oracle Database와의 통신을 종료합니다.

oci_close($conn);



# OCI-Commit 함수의 오류 처리


OCI-Commit 함수의 오류 처리는 다음과 같습니다.

#hostingforum.kr
php

//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 생성합니다.

$conn = oci_connect('사용자 이름', '비밀번호', 'Oracle Database 주소');



//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 확인합니다.

if (!$conn) {

    $m = oci_error();

    echo $m['message'];

    exit;

}



try {

    // Oracle Database에 INSERT 문을 실행합니다.

    $stmt = oci_parse($conn, "INSERT INTO 테이블 이름 (컬럼 이름) VALUES ('값')");

    oci_execute($stmt);



    // OCI-Commit 함수를 호출합니다.

    oci_commit($conn);

} catch (Exception $e) {

    // 오류 메시지를 출력합니다.

    echo $e->getMessage();

}



// Oracle Database와의 통신을 종료합니다.

oci_close($conn);



# OCI-Commit 함수의 성능 최적화


OCI-Commit 함수의 성능 최적화는 다음과 같습니다.

#hostingforum.kr
php

//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 생성합니다.

$conn = oci_connect('사용자 이름', '비밀번호', 'Oracle Database 주소');



//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 확인합니다.

if (!$conn) {

    $m = oci_error();

    echo $m['message'];

    exit;

}



// Oracle Database에 INSERT 문을 실행합니다.

$stmt = oci_parse($conn, "INSERT INTO 테이블 이름 (컬럼 이름) VALUES ('값')");

oci_execute($stmt);



// OCI-Commit 함수를 호출합니다.

oci_commit($conn);



// Oracle Database와의 통신을 종료합니다.

oci_close($conn);



# OCI-Commit 함수의 보안 고려 사항


OCI-Commit 함수의 보안 고려 사항은 다음과 같습니다.

#hostingforum.kr
php

//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 생성합니다.

$conn = oci_connect('사용자 이름', '비밀번호', 'Oracle Database 주소');



// Oracle Database와의 통신을 위해 사용되는 커넥션 객체를 확인합니다.

if (!$conn) {

    $m = oci_error();

    echo $m['message'];

    exit;

}



// Oracle Database에 INSERT 문을 실행합니다.

$stmt = oci_parse($conn, "INSERT INTO 테이블 이름 (컬럼 이름) VALUES ('값')");

oci_execute($stmt);



// OCI-Commit 함수를 호출합니다.

oci_commit($conn);



// Oracle Database와의 통신을 종료합니다.

oci_close($conn);



# OCI-Commit 함수의 장단점


OCI-Commit 함수의 장단점은 다음과 같습니다.

장점:

* 트랜잭션을 커밋하는 데 사용됩니다.
* Oracle Database와의 통신을 위해 사용됩니다.

단점:

* 오류가 발생할 경우 트랜잭션이 롤백됩니다.
* 성능 최적화가 필요합니다.

# OCI-Commit 함수의 결론


OCI-Commit 함수는 Oracle Database와의 통신을 위해 사용되는 함수입니다. 이 함수는 트랜잭션을 커밋하는 데 사용됩니다. OCI-Commit 함수의 장단점을 고려하여 사용해야 합니다.
  • profile_image
    나우호스팅 @pcs8404 

    호스팅포럼 화이팅!

    댓글목록

    등록된 댓글이 없습니다.

  • 전체 10,077건 / 364 페이지

검색

게시물 검색